Learning from other cultures has been a defining experience for me as an artist and as a human. We, as people, have so much in common with our neighbours yet that concept can be hard to grasp especially when so many, like the Rendille and Samburu, live hidden away in a pocket of the world most will never visit. At the end of the day we all have many of the same priorities, so I have created my images as a demonstration of our global humanity. I strongly feel that the subjects captured within these photos will help, if only for a second, allow us to appreciate and understand shared human interests, despite geographical differences.
